Performance Analysis And Application Of Sleeping Exhaust Polling Control

With the development of information technology and other leaders,people are committed to seeking more computing power,more storage capacity and faster processing speed,but small-scale automation equipment has taken more and more part in daily life.Units with data processing,data storage,context awareness,and mutual communication capabilities have almost entered the full range of human activities.The network of these small communication units has accelerated the range of people's ability to collect information.In a large wireless sensor network consisting of thousands of entities,each node requires its ability to detect locations and share it with others,which requires that the nodes have the ability to work long hours.However,the lifetime of a wireless sensor network node is usually defined by the lifetime of a battery charge.Due to the limited sensor energy,it is difficult to charge and replace the battery in a large-scale WSN.Therefore,avoiding energy waste and optimizing the energy consumption within each sensor node is critical in wireless sensor networks.This article mainly starts from reducing the idle energy consumption of the Media Access Control layer nodes in wireless sensor networks,and introduces the dormant state in the exhaust polling system,and adopts the analysis method of Markov chain and probability generating function.Modeling and analysis were performed,and first-order and higher-order characteristic quantities such as average queue length,average query period,and average waiting time were derived.Simulation experiments verified the correctness of the theoretical analysis.Compared with the classical exhaust system,the calculation accuracy was obtained.A big increase.Based on this,this paper proposes a Sleeping Exhaust Polling Control(S-EPC)with Sleep for WSN,analyzes the access control process,and based on IEEE 802.11 PCF frame structure.The frame structure of S-EPC was designed,and finally the energy consumption of nodes was analyzed.Simulation experiments show that while taking into account service performance,system energy consumption has been greatly reduced,and it canmeet the application requirements of WSN.
Keywords/Search Tags:Polling mechanism, Probability generating function, Markov chain, Wireless sensor network, MAC protocol
